|  | #include <linux/init.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/types.h> | 
|  | #include <linux/io.h> | 
|  | #include <asm/txx9/tx4927.h> | 
|  |  | 
|  | static unsigned int __init tx4927_process_sdccr(u64 __iomem *addr) | 
|  | { | 
|  | u64 val; | 
|  | unsigned int sdccr_ce; | 
|  | unsigned int sdccr_bs; | 
|  | unsigned int sdccr_rs; | 
|  | unsigned int sdccr_cs; | 
|  | unsigned int sdccr_mw; | 
|  | unsigned int bs = 0; | 
|  | unsigned int rs = 0; | 
|  | unsigned int cs = 0; | 
|  | unsigned int mw = 0; | 
|  |  | 
|  | val = __raw_readq(addr); |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* MVMCP -- need #defs for these bits masks */ | 
|  | sdccr_ce = ((val & (1 << 10)) >> 10); | 
|  | sdccr_bs = ((val & (1 << 8)) >> 8); | 
|  | sdccr_rs = ((val & (3 << 5)) >> 5); | 
|  | sdccr_cs = ((val & (7 << 2)) >> 2); | 
|  | sdccr_mw = ((val & (1 << 0)) >> 0); |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(sdccr_ce) { | 
|  | bs = 2 << sdccr_bs; | 
|  | rs = 2048 << sdccr_rs; | 
|  | cs = 256 << sdccr_cs; | 
|  | mw = 8 >> sdccr_mw;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| return rs * cs * mw * bs;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| unsigned int __init tx4927_get_mem_size(void) | 
|  | { | 
|  | unsigned int total = 0; | 
|  | int i; | 
|  |  | 
|  | for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(tx4927_sdramcptr->cr); i++) | 
|  | total += tx4927_process_sdccr(&tx4927_sdramcptr->cr[i]); | 
|  | return total; | 
|  | } |
